Opportunity description

MCI | The Entrepreneurial School is offering a scholarship under the patronage of Excellency Ban Ki-moon shall allow students engaged in the SDGs

to study and develop at a prestigious university institution in Europe. The scholarship is applicable for the first year of the respective master program.

Eligibility Criteria:

  • The applicants should have nationality of Non-EU countries
  • The applicants should have Bachelor degree
  • Students who have been engaged and committed to the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and aim to further engage with and promote these goals during their studies.

Requirements:

  • Copy of submitted application to MCI masters' programs
  • Written application & CV
  • Undergraduate degree
  • Non-European citizenship (not applicable for Executive Master)
  • Documented engagement in SDG
  • Language proficiency
  • A statement (approximately 500 words) that recounts the applicant’s current (or past) commitment to
  • one or several SDGs including reference to concrete evidence / documentation.
  • A motivation letter describing the applicant’s future goals in support of the SDG(s) and explaining how
  • their chosen MCI degree will help them achieve these aims. The motivation letter should also explain
  • how applicants would benefit from the awarded scholarship (financial aspects).

Scholarship Value:

€ 10,000

About MCI | The Entrepreneurial School:

MCI Management Center Innsbruck is a privately organized business school in Innsbruck, Austria, offering study programs leading to Bachelor and Master degrees as well as Executive Master programs, Executive Certificate programs, Management seminars, Customized programs and research.
